CMA CGM Opens Corridor in Libreville

April 8, 2015

Image: CMA CGM
Image: CMA CGM
CMA CGM announced the opening of a new corridor to Gabon's inland destinations via the port of Libreville.
 
Coverage of Gabon's major locations (Franceville, Lambarene, Mouila, Bitam, Moanda, Mitzic, Makokou) is provided by rail and by road.
